Vice President, Network Engineer

State Street

Vice President in the Global Data Center & Cloud Network team focusing on hybrid cloud networking and infrastructure design. Leading a global organization in developing multi-cloud hybrid architecture standards.

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Development and deployment of hybrid network design standards
  • Expertise in deploying WAN and data center connectivity and routing principles
  • Responsible for designing, implementing, and supporting the network infrastructure based on the defined standards
  • Ability to clearly articulate network design principles and requirements to cross-functional teams within State Street as well as cloud service provider teams
  • Act as a point of escalation for critical issues involving cloud performance and connectivity
  • Participate and approve networking updates via our CI/CD Pipelines and git workflows
  • Drive the implementation of global hybrid connectivity to Cloud Providers via dedicated circuits (ExpressRoute, FastConnect, DirectConnect)
  • Act as the subject matter expert in the design and implementation of cloud routing platforms such as AWS CloudWan and Azure vWAN
  • Experience with deploying Cisco VxLAN/EVPN /BGP environments
  • Ensure compliance with the standards and requirements relative to cyber security
  • Leverage network tools to automate, manage, and troubleshoot the network
  • Create and maintain network documentation and diagrams

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Bachelor's Degree
  • 10+ years’ experience in network industry
  • Experience with AWS and Azure network concepts
  • Basic knowledge of python and terraform scripting
  • Experience with large scale application migrations to cloud
  • Knowledge of hybrid extranet and internet topologies, design, and implementations
  • Proven experience in developing design standards and configuration standards documentation
  • Proven effectiveness in the areas of Vendor management, cost analysis, and RFP frameworks
